DVTEL, INC., recently announced that it has received Lenel factory certification and joined the Lenel OpenAccess Alliance Program (OAAP). DVTEL’s Latitude Network Video Management System (NVMS) integrates with Lenel’s OnGuard® access control system to allow the correlation of video surveillance and access control data through a single interface.

“DVTEL has completed the required factory testing at Lenel to validate the functionality of its interface to OnGuard. End users can now leverage the power of both platforms to build a security system that provides a comprehensive view of all video and access points within a facility,” said Gidon Lissai, director, strategic alliances, Lenel. “We look forward to DVTEL’s continued involvement in the Lenel OpenAccess Alliance Program.”

“Today’s users require open systems that provide ease of integration to other devices and systems to enable the development of a best-in-class solution that provides an overarching view of an enterprise’s entire security operation,” said Yoav Stern, president and CEO, DVTEL. “By integrating Latitude with open access control systems, such as Lenel’s OnGuard, we can provide the industry with the most effective security technologies while minimizing any integration challenges.”

The Latitude NVMS is a fully scalable, enterprise-class video management system. Its network-based architecture enables simultaneous live monitoring from multiple stations and is easily configurable for storage on and off-site. Latitude can be configured to store and view one camera or thousands of cameras and is able to monitor across an unlimited number of servers. The 6.2 version of Latitude includes TruWitness™, an award-winning mobile application that transforms Android-based smart phones into real-time surveillance cameras and provides users with a level of situational awareness that was previously unavailable.
